Get PriceA crusher is a machine designed to reduce large rocks into smaller rocks, gravel, or rock dust.. Crushers may be used to reduce the size, or change the form, of waste materials so they can be more easily disposed of or recycled, or to reduce the size of a solid mix of raw materials (as in rock ore), so that pieces of different composition can be differentiated.
Get PriceJan 23, 2017· Rock crushers are machine build to break large rocks into much smaller rocks, gravel, or sometimes rock dust. They are an important tool for most commercial mining operations. Rock crushers usually hold the rocks to be crushed in between two solid surfaces and apply a force that forces the molecule of the materials to separate or change alignment.

Get PriceAn underground crusher assures the size reduction to practical sizes and therefore plays an important part in the mining operation as a whole. There are two possible locations for an underground crusher: near the shaft and under the ore body.
